WRK/360
WRK/360 provides coaching and training programs to support your organizations working parents and caregivers. WRK/360's programs are designed for employees and their managers navigating the intersection of care and career from new parenthood through eldercare. WRK/360's three core programs include: Parental Leave at WRK, coaching and training for employees and their managers as they plan for leave and return to work. Parents & Caregivers at WRK, coaching, community, and resources for employees navigating their ongoing care journey while growing their career. Fair Play at WRK, a 3-month cohort program to tackle burnout, reduce the mental load, manage invisible work and improve equity at home and at work.

Fair Play Book
With her acclaimed New York Times bestseller (and Reese’s Book Club pick) Fair Play, Eve Rodsky began a national conversation about greater equality on the home front. But she soon realized that even when the domestic workload becomes more balanced, people still report something missing in their lives—that is, unless they create and prioritize time for activities that not only fill their calendars but also unleash their creativity.
